Nepal: Magic Sand Mandalas33 min
Available from 28/03/2026
In Nepal, in the Thrangu Tara monastery near Kathmandu, nuns have the privilege of creating sand mandalas, intricate geometric configurations of symbols, painstakingly assembled from grains of sand. These astonishingly beautiful creations are destroyed to remind Buddhists of the transitory nature of all things.
